The skills/experience you mention (i.e. travel/tourism/hotel) fit very well in Cyprus business "landscape", so to say. What I can tell you from my previous experience is that languages are the key in tourism. I speak german and english and a bit of greek but would for example have desperately needed french as the company I was working for in Cyprus had acquired a big new french customer....
Taking an optimistic look into the future I would guess that knowledge of both greek and turkish should be very useful.
